StormRelay fan-out service (Aldevik Weather Group) runs in three environments: dev, staging, and prod. Dev uses synthetic alert feeds; staging mirrors prod traffic at 10%. Only prod dispatches to subscriber channels. Each environment has its own queue cluster and rate limits. Deployments promote automatically from staging after soak tests pass. Staging runs with the following configuration values.

deployment values, bahif-bagep:
FENIEL_PIN=6351
FENIEL_TENANT=ulays
FENIEL_METRICS_HOST=metrics.feniel.novacdata.test
FENIEL_SEAL=seal_8d076180
FENIEL_STANDBY_TEAM=ulair

## Deploying the Gatewick Proctor Queue

Deploys are pretty painless: push to main, wait for the pipeline, then watch the queue drain dashboard for five minutes. If candidates pile up mid-exam, roll back first and ask questions later — the queue replays safely. Everything the workers care about lives in one config block, shown here for reference.

settings of bafof-yagef:
JOROX_PIN=8740
JOROX_TENANT=pelox
JOROX_METRICS_HOST=metrics.jorox.qorvelworks.internal
JOROX_SEAL=seal_c78f63c1
JOROX_STANDBY_TEAM=norax

## Authentication

The StormRelay fan-out service pushes weather alerts from the Nimbusline ingest feed to regional subscriber shards. All outbound calls to the shard routers are signed; inbound admin calls require a token minted by the Gatehouse service. On-call engineers should use the shared admin credential only for incident triage — day-to-day changes go through the deploy pipeline. Tokens rotate weekly and stale ones fail closed. For manual triage requests, supply the internal Gatehouse API key shown below.

app token of tagef-tafog = qvz3-7n0